HOUSTON, May 13 – TAG Oil Ltd., Vancouver, BC, said it improved oil and gas production from the Cheal-A7 well more than 3.5 times to 292 b/d of oil equivalent by administering a 17-ton frac job on the Miocene Mount Messenger formation.
It was the company’s first frac stimulation since it acquired a 100% interest in the field in late 2009. The well is choked to minimize frac sand flowback and is expected to take 2 weeks to clean up.
TAG has a large inventory of prospects identified on 3D seismic on the lightly explored Cheal Production License and plans a drilling campaign that will include horizontal drilling with multistage fracturing combined with downhole heating and advanced recovery technologies.
